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sWhat Women Said "Melania" Director Brett Ratner Did to Them
In 2017, at the height of the #MeToo movement, six actresses told the Los Angeles Times that a prominent Hollywood director was sexually violent toward them.
Natasha Henstridge said he forced her to give him oral sex. Olivia Munn said that he masturbated in front of her, then lied to others that theyd had sex. Jaime Ray Newman shared that hed sexually harassed her on a flight. According to Katharine Towne, the director followed her into the bathroom at a party after making unwanted advances. Jorina King detailed hiding from him in the bathroom; seemingly in exchange for a speaking part in a film, she said that he went into her trailer and asked to see her breasts. Eri Sasaki said that, on set, he repeatedly asked her to enter a bathroom with him, and when she declined, he allegedly said: Dont you want to be famous?
They were talking about Brett Ratner, who on Thursday will stand next to Melania Trump to celebrate the premiere of Melania, his eponymous documentary about the First Lady.
In a 2018 interview about the #MeToo movement, the First Lady told ABC News, I support the womenthey need to be heard. We need to support them. And also men, not just women, adding that accusers cannot just say to somebody I was sexually assaulted or You did that to me. Because sometimes the media goes too far and the way they portray some stories, its not correct. Its not right.

Working on the film wasnt easy money, explained yet another source, as people were worked really hard on the production. And the person most commonly cited for causing those hard conditions is director Brett Ratner.
One Melania crew member told Rolling Stone that Ratner was slimy. Melania Trump, while boring, they said, was totally nice.....
Brett Ratner was the worst part of working on this project, another crew member said. While others were put off by Ratners reported lack of cleanliness (he left a constant trail of discarded orange peels and gum wrappers everywhere he went, according to the crew), others said the director was less than charming.
The Daily Beast has reached out Ratners company for comment.
The report includes an anecdote about Ratner eating in the grubbiest way possible while crew members were not allowed a meal break. One said Ratner was either being a d--- or had no awareness whatsoever. Another said he dropped his chewed gum into a cup of coffee on her cart and didnt acknowledge my existence.
